Highfields
8.9 km south-west of Newcastle city centreCity of Lake Macquarie9 min to Dudley Beach6 min to Lake Macquarienext to Mount Hutton and Windale
Elevated residential suburb with views from some positions and quiet streets, within reach of the Kotara and Charlestown shopping centres. Compact, and flies under the radar.

Price trajectory
Median house price: $990k from 16 sales in the 12 months to May 2026.
This is a thin market. Fewer than 30 homes sold here in the past year, so the figure above moves a long way on a single unusual sale. Read it as a rough guide, not a firm price.
NSW Valuer General via nswpropertysalesdata.com Sales settled in the 12 months to May 2026
